☆ Be the first to review + Add to your collection — Join freeA group of luminous, ghostly figures surge upward from the curve of the Earth toward a blazing light in deep space, while below them loom the imposing mechanical visages of what appear to be armored or robotic sentinels — a quietly stunning image that captures the sweeping, cosmic scale this series does so well. Alex Ross's cover art bathes everything in an eerie silver-white glow that feels both otherworldly and strangely mournful. With Krueger, Leon, and Reinhold driving the story, Earth X #11 continues Marvel's ambitious 2000 reimagining of its entire universe at full momentum.

Captain America kills the Skull. Black Bolt dies fighting the Celestials, while Iron Man prepares to join the battle.
